backend-rdp: make sure to finish frames with timestamps in the past

Round up the ms delay to make sure that the finish_frame_timer always
expires after the next frame_time. That way, finish_frame_handler()
never passes a timestamp in the future to weston_output_finish_frame().
Setting frame_time into the future risks hitting an assert in
weston_output_finish_frame(), when it is called from start_repaint_loop
within the frame interval.
